Here’s a look at the completed card. I used some green cardstock for the base. The base with the HO HO HO is a cut in the Artfully Sent cartridge. I used the Design Space software and my Artfully sent cartridge to create this adorable little reindeer piecing.

reindeercardface-500
Here’s a closer look at the stamped sentiment. The frame and the sentiment are both also in the Artfully Sent bundle. I used my Cranberry Ink Pad to stamp the frame and sentiment. The tag is already in the Artfully sent cartridge too.

artfully sent reindeer card sideview-500
Here is just a slight side view to show that I used a little foam tape to give the reindeer piecing and the sentiment a little lift. I finished off the card with a little bow. I also added some Gold Glitz stickles to his little wreath to jazz it up. The papers I used were once again from the DCWV Evergreen Stack.

Hello crafty friends, Thank you once again for joining me on this Crafty adventure. Today, I have a super quick and cute Card-Gift Card Holder to share with you. 

ornament card holder-450
Here’s a look at my finished card. I used a cute ornament cut file from the Pazzles Craft RoomOf COURSE, I used some fun, FLASHY and festive Die Cuts With A View DCWV patterned paper from the DCWV Evergreen Paper Stack!

card holder opened-450
Here is a shot of the inside of the card. It has a nice little fold inside so that it will hold a gift card!!!!

So here’s how to assemble the card.
ornament card holder folding-450
Here is a view of the inside of the card. To create the card simply take a piece of cardstock 5.5 x 11 and score at 4.25”, 5.5” and 6.75”. You will fold them together to create the “pocket”. Place adhesive on the three sides to create the sandwich.

card slot-cu-450b
Trim a slit about one inch in from each edge and it will make a perfect pocket for your gift card. This is actually the crease that the paper is folded on.
You will have a standard size card to decorate and done! Simple, easy and effective.
